A sequence is a named, reusable group of connected workflow nodes. Instead of rebuilding the same node patterns in every workflow, you can capture a pattern once, save it to the sequence library, and insert it into any workflow with a single action.
Sequence types
Sequences come in two types:
| Type | What is saved |
|---|---|
| Structure | Nodes and their links only. Configuration is not saved, so you fill in the settings each time the sequence is inserted. |
| Configured | Nodes, links, and all parameter values. The sequence is ready to use as-is after insertion. |
Sequences are unchangeable. Once saved, a sequence cannot be edited. To update a pattern, save a new sequence and remove or replace the old one in the workflows that use it. This protects existing workflows from unintended changes.
Sequence library
The sequence library is the central management view for all sequences in the workspace. To open it, go to Automation Hub > Sequences.

The library shows the following information for each sequence:
| Column | Description |
|---|---|
| Name | The display name assigned when the sequence was saved. |
| Type | Structure or Configured. |
| Created | When the sequence was created. |
| Last used | When the sequence was last inserted into a workflow. |
Organizing sequences into folders
You can create folders to group related sequences.
To add a folder:
- In the left panel, click Add folder.
- Enter the folder name and confirm.
To move a sequence to a folder, click next to the sequence and select Move to.
Filtering sequences
- Use the All, Structure, and Configured tabs in the left panel to filter by type.
- Use Select tag to filter by tag. Tags are shared with workflow tags, so any tag you create here also appears in workflows and vice versa.
- Use the search icon in the upper-right corner of the list to search by name.
Saving a selection as a sequence
You can save any group of connected nodes from a workflow canvas as a sequence.
Requirements
- The workflow must be saved at least as a draft before you can save a sequence from it.
- The selected nodes must form a single connected chain with no gaps.
Procedure
- On the workflow canvas, select the nodes you want to save.
- Hold Shift and click individual nodes, or drag a selection box around the desired area.

Selected nodes with the Save as Sequence toolbar - In the toolbar that appears above the selection, click the Save as Sequence icon.
Result: The Save as Sequence dialog opens.

The Save as Sequence dialog - In the Name your sequence field, enter a name for the sequence.
- From the Folder dropdown, select the folder where the sequence will be saved.
If you want to create a new folder, click Add folder in the dropdown. - Optionally, add tags to help organize and find the sequence later.
From the Type dropdown, select the sequence type:
- Structure - saves nodes and connections only, without configuration.
- Configured - saves nodes, connections, and all configured parameter values.
- Click Save.
Result: The Sequence is saved and appears in the Sequence Library.
Inserting a sequence into a workflow
You can insert a sequence into a workflow in two ways: from the workflow canvas, or directly from the sequence library.
From the workflow canvas
- On the workflow canvas, click the THEN button on the node after which you want to insert the sequence.
Result: A node picker opens. Sequences appears at the top of the list.

The node picker showing Sequences - Click Sequences.
Result: The sequence library opens as a picker. - Find the sequence you want to insert and click it.
Result: The nodes from the sequence appear on the canvas. - If the sequence type is Structure, configure each node before saving or activating the workflow.
If the sequence type is Configured, review the node settings and adjust any values specific to the current workflow.
From the sequence library
- Go to Automation Hub > Sequences.
- Find the sequence you want to use.
- Click
next to the sequence and select Start with sequence.
Result: A new workflow is created with the sequence nodes already placed on the canvas.
Deleting a sequence
Deleting a sequence does not affect workflows that have already used it - the nodes are already inserted to those canvases. However, the sequence will no longer be available to insert into new workflows.
To delete a sequence:
- Go to Automation Hub > Sequences.
- Find the sequence you want to delete.
- Click
on the right side of the row.
- Select Delete and confirm.
